岗位职责:
Patient Safety - The CMO will be accountable for delivering safe care for all of their responsible patients and will:
• Reinforce the message that patient safety is at the heart of all of the company’s clinical
activities with the aspiration of becoming a zero avoidable harm, high reliability kidney care provider.
• Demonstrate authentic leadership to teammates (TMs) in pursuit of a positive safety culture and a learning healthcare environment.
• Impress upon TMs the importance of constant surveillance of the patient environment and patient care activities for potential risks to safety. This will include the reporting of ‘near
misses’ as well adverse occurrences.
• Hold physicians accountable for centralized safety and adverse event reporting.
• Participate in the investigation (eg. root cause analysis) of adverse occurrences and support the clinic teams in the analysis, remediation and feedback of findings/action plan to TMs.
• Discuss where relevant cases that require escalation with the country Nursing Lead / DCS in accordance with the company policies and procedures.
• Be responsible for accurate and timely central reporting of Safety related KPIs for their region.
• Maintain meticulous documentation of any safety related issues as required.
Clinical Performance and Quality - The CMO will have direct accountability and oversight of all aspects of clinical care in their region, including:
• Responsibility for each clinic achieving its preset clinical KPI goals.
• Overseeing and defining scope of clinical quality improvement (QI) programs for their clinics.
• Clinical KPI reporting (eg. Fundamentals, PROMs. Etc.).
• Overseeing clinical audits in partnership with the DCS.
• Ensuring that biomed reporting and processes are fulfilled in partnership with the country biomed lead.
• Helping with physician change management related to rollouts of new initiatives and clinical performance.
• Implementing standardized clinical governance and audit processes.
• Establishing a strategy for holding physicians accountable for outcomes.
• Establishing complex programs and educational programs (diabetic foot examination, nutritional, wellbeing, exercise, etc.) to drive QI.
• Partaking in regular quality meetings with clinic teams on a regular basis (eg. Huddles, Safety Briefings, QAPIs, etc.).
• Where a clinic or group of patients is receiving care not in keeping with the company’s clinical standards, the CMO will provide direct support to improve clinical quality.
• Involvement in clinical due diligence when requested by the country GM.
Patient Experience - The CMO will participate in reviews of patient experience for clinics in their area in partnership with the country Director of Clinical Services (DCS) and operations team. This may be through:
• Survey results.
• Studies of Patient Reported Experience Measures (PREMs).
• Direct patient feedback/complaints.
• Chairing a patient participation group to canvas opinion of patients to help improve their care/co-production of services.
The CMO may be required to act as an extra point of contact should communication between a
patient and the TMs in their clinic not meet patient needs. The CMO will also be expected to work with other functional teams to ensure that patient experience is of the highest quality and
differentiated. This may involve co-design of programs to improve experience.
Medical Education - There will be a need for the CMO to be involved in educational programs where necessary by:
• Developing high quality medical education materials for physicians, nurses or other relevant stakeholders.
• Delivering teaching in to TMs by a number of methods (eg. In person, online).
• Identify areas of educational need related to safety or quality performance and target education programs to meet those needs.
Physician Engagement - The CMO will assist with physician engagement including:
• Assisting the Country GM in short and long term strategy, objectives and execution for DVA physician engagement programs.
• Organizing local physician networks.
• Developing recruitment and retention strategies.
• Developing nephrology fellow/medical student/other physicians engagement activities.
• Coordinating regional quality circles and summits.
• Leading physician change management activities.
• Design and implementation of the physician components of change management communications.
Other - At the request of the General Manager/International CMO, the country CMO may be required to assist with:
• Clinical research (eg. Epidemiological, de novo research).
